Output fd91a6eb0ad3d64817d5fd24edfb02379b0e82be6bf8e99c0ce019fa5aed18cb:1

value
10529390
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d253e229f6b6f29a5224854619a1ff215d3c57dd OP_EQUAL
address
3Ls8K9ofqZeLnefeGtvU3F2UqrTK1w2ieE
transaction
fd91a6eb0ad3d64817d5fd24edfb02379b0e82be6bf8e99c0ce019fa5aed18cb
spent
true